About the Franklinville 27248 market
What is the median home price in Franklinville 27248, NC?
The median sale price in Franklinville 27248, NC is $165,833 (data through July 2026), based on deeds recorded with the county. That is down 10.0% from a year earlier.
How many homes sell in Franklinville 27248, NC each year?
49 homes sold in Franklinville 27248, NC over the last 12 months (data through July 2026). TopHap counts recorded arm's-length deeds, not listings, so the figure is not affected by which brokerage handled the sale.
Is Franklinville 27248, NC a buyer's or seller's market?
Franklinville 27248, NC is currently a buyer's market, scoring 29 out of 100 on TopHap's market temperature index (data through July 2026). The score weighs sales velocity and price direction; above 60 favours sellers, below 40 favours buyers.
How many homes are there in Franklinville 27248, NC?
Franklinville 27248, NC contains 1,975 residential properties, with a median of 1,462 square feet, 3 bedrooms, built around 1979. The median TopHap Estimate is $203K.
How does Franklinville 27248, NC compare to the rest of Randolph County?
By median home value, Franklinville 27248, NC is the 11th most expensive of 12 ZIP codes in Randolph County. Its typical home is worth more than 34% of all homes in Randolph County. Seagrove 27341 ranks just above it and Asheboro 27203 just below. The ranking is rebuilt nightly from the county assessor record of every home in each area.
Do people own or rent in Franklinville 27248, NC?
72% of homes in Franklinville 27248, NC are owner-occupied. 8% are held by a company rather than an individual.
How much equity do owners in Franklinville 27248, NC hold?
65% of mortgaged homes in Franklinville 27248, NC are equity-rich, meaning the loan balance is under half the home's value. 2.9% owe more than the home is worth.
